The HUL share price target 2025 faces scrutiny after Q4 FY25 results.
HUL’s stock fell 3.1% to ₹2,348.6 as margins dropped to 22.8% from 23% last year, below the expected 23.1%.
Revenue grew 2.4% to ₹15,213 crore, with a 2% volume rise, beating forecasts.
Net profit hit ₹2,493 crore, aligning with estimates.
Despite a final dividend of ₹24/share, management’s lowered margin outlook (22-23%) and focus on volume-led growth raised worries.
Analysts remain cautious, with price targets ranging from ₹2,338 to ₹3,225, reflecting mixed growth and margin outlooks.
